Swiggy has narrowed its losses in the April-June quarter as revenue rose, marking a significant shift in the company's financial trajectory. This development is crucial for India's food delivery market, where competition is fierce and profitability is a major challenge.
Technically, Swiggy's improved financials can be attributed to its optimized logistics and increased efficiency in its delivery network. The company has been investing in AI-powered tools to streamline its operations, reduce costs, and enhance customer experience. For instance, Swiggy's algorithm-driven delivery system ensures that orders are allocated to the nearest available restaurants and delivery partners, minimizing delays and reducing the likelihood of cancellations.
In the broader industry context, Swiggy's progress is a significant milestone, especially considering the intense competition in the food delivery space. Companies like Zomato, Uber Eats, and Ola Food have been vying for market share, with some players even exiting the market due to unsustainable losses. According to a recent report, India's food delivery market is expected to reach $8 billion by 2025, with Swiggy and Zomato being the leading players.
In the India tech ecosystem, Swiggy's turnaround has a positive impact on the startup community, demonstrating that with the right strategy and execution, it is possible to achieve profitability in a highly competitive market. Indian companies like Flipkart, Ola, and Paytm have been expanding their services, and Swiggy's success story can inspire other startups to focus on operational efficiency and customer satisfaction.
